Kaizen and Monozukuri

Kaizen and monozukuri are the foundations of Japanese manufacturing excellence. Kaizen focuses on continuous, incremental improvements that lead to significant enhancements over time. Monozukuri refers to the spirit and dedication towards craftsmanship, embracing both manufacturing skill and innovative processes.

Types of Surface Treatments Used by Japanese Manufacturers

Understanding the various surface treatment methods employed by Japanese manufacturers is crucial for leveraging their expertise. They use a wide range of techniques tailored for different materials and applications. Here are some of the most commonly utilized methods:

Electroplating

Electroplating involves the use of an electric current to reduce cations of a metal to form a coherent metal coating on an electrode. This method is frequently used for decorative purposes, corrosion protection, and lubrication.

Anodizing

Anodizing is a passivation process, used to increase the thickness of the natural oxide layer on the surface of metal parts. Typically applied to aluminum, anodizing enhances corrosion resistance and wear properties while providing a better surface for paint adherence.

Powder Coating

In powder coating, a dry powder is electrostatically applied to a surface and then cured under heat. This technique is well-known for creating a hard finish that is tougher than conventional paint, and it is extensively used for automotive and appliance industries.
